repo.or.cz
/
hiphop-php.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add dynamic to TypeStructure
2019-06-26
Kuna
l
Mehta
Add dynami
c
to TypeStructure
commit
|
commitdiff
|
tree
2019-06-26
Tatiana Rache
v
a
Type checker options:
Defer class decl
a
ra
t
io
n
commit
|
commitdiff
|
tree
2019-06-26
Tat
i
ana Racheva
`
De
f
erred_decl` mo
d
ul
e
:
S
torage for dependencies and
.
.
.
commit
|
commitdiff
|
tree
2019-06-26
Katy Voor
Parser Option to require
c
o
n
s
t
ant visibility m
o
dif
i
ers
commit
|
commitdiff
|
tree
2019-06-26
Jan
Oravec
Fi
x
inlineability of callers of ge
t
_cl
a
s
s
_
me
t
hods()
commit
|
commitdiff
|
tree
2019-06-26
T
a
t
i
a
na Racheva
A
d
d a way to generate
a save-s
t
at
e
J
SON spec
commit
|
commitdiff
|
tree
2019-06-26
Tatiana
R
acheva
Using the utils libr
a
ry in server args
commit
|
commitdiff
|
tree
2019-06-26
Anmol Jadvani
A
dds basic
functionality to T
y
ping_sy
m
b
o
l_info_wr
i
ter
commit
|
commitdiff
|
tree
2019-06-26
Anmol J
a
dvani
A
d
d flag to hh_server for st
o
r
i
n
g
symbol
i
nforma
t
ion
commit
|
commitdiff
|
tree
2019-06-26
Bin Li
u
su
p
p
ort local_free
in StringHo
l
der
commit
|
commitdiff
|
tree
2019-06-26
K
unal
M
ehta
Unify fun
c
tion a
u
toimport implementat
i
o
n
with typechecker
commit
|
commitdiff
|
tree
2019-06-26
Elijah
R
i
vera
Accoun
t
for offset when checking for overlappin
g
instruction
.
.
.
commit
|
commitdiff
|
tree
2019-06-25
Bin L
i
u
o
p
tions to
con
t
rol whether to
the use l
o
cal
a
llo
c
ators
.
.
.
commit
|
commitdiff
|
tree
2019-06-25
Paul
Bissonne
t
t
e
Run
_
_
E
ntryPoint for
xbox tasks
commit
|
commitdiff
|
tree
2019-06-25
Mat
Hostetter
D
elete
obsolete skip
i
f: the test no longer has a destructor
.
commit
|
commitdiff
|
tree
2019-06-25
O
guz
U
lgen
Bump FixedStringMap::init lo
g
ging to
4
commit
|
commitdiff
|
tree
2019-06-25
Kevin Viraty
o
sin
D
e
serializ
e
lists and ma
p
s
a
s
v
/darray
commit
|
commitdiff
|
tree
2019-06-25
Ted Spence
Fix
i
ssue where glean results were not pruned
commit
|
commitdiff
|
tree
2019-06-25
Fr
e
d Emmott
Upd
a
te FB dependencies in third-pa
r
ty/ to
v
2019
.
06
.
.
.
commit
|
commitdiff
|
tree
2019-06-25
Tatiana Rache
v
a
Fix global conf
i
g overrid
e
s
commit
|
commitdiff
|
tree
2019-06-25
M
ark
W
i
lliams
Fix AttrNoOverr
i
de* on
c
las
s
es
commit
|
commitdiff
|
tree
2019-06-25
Ben Har
r
iso
n
Declare "main" Entr
y
P
oin
t
s
a
s returning void in tests
.
commit
|
commitdiff
|
tree
2019-06-25
Ben Harrison
D
e
cla
r
e "main" as returning
void
in "*
.
ski
p
if" files
.
commit
|
commitdiff
|
tree
2019-06-25
Wi
l
fre
d
Hug
h
e
s
Use
d
eriving e
n
u
m
on L
S
P types
commit
|
commitdiff
|
tree
2019-06-25
K
atja Golt
s
ova
Do
not typeche
c
k
the entire file
w
hen e
x
tractin
g
depen
d
encie
.
.
.
commit
|
commitdiff
|
tree
2019-06-25
Tati
a
na
R
acheva
Point command API tes
t
s to t
e
st
command A
P
I
commit
|
commitdiff
|
tree
2019-06-25
Tatia
n
a Rac
h
eva
Move ServerArg
s
t
e
st -> Command
A
PI tests
commit
|
commitdiff
|
tree
2019-06-25
Tatiana Racheva
Refactoring some args logic into a ut
i
ls library
commit
|
commitdiff
|
tree
2019-06-25
Steve Cao
cache peek_next_tok
e
n in lex
e
r(2/2)
commit
|
commitdiff
|
tree
2019-06-25
Ted Sp
e
n
c
e
Add completion mes
s
ag
e
to SIDE
commit
|
commitdiff
|
tree
2019-06-25
T
ed Spe
n
ce
Move Clien
t
I
d
eMessage to open sourc
e
commit
|
commitdiff
|
tree
2019-06-25
Hunter Goldstein
Mark `Pair::toArray` as `__PHPStdLi
b
`
commit
|
commitdiff
|
tree
2019-06-25
St
e
ve Cao
por
t
D
15698
5
60
commit
|
commitdiff
|
tree
2019-06-25
Tatiana Racheva
Int
e
gration ML
runner sho
u
ld fail if it's asked to
.
.
.
commit
|
commitdiff
|
tree
2019-06-25
T
a
t
i
ana
R
ach
e
va
F
i
x
i
ng test_server_hover
commit
|
commitdiff
|
tree
2019-06-24
St
e
ve Cao
c
a
c
he peek_next
_
token in lexer(1/2)
commit
|
commitdiff
|
tree
2019-06-24
V
assil
M
l
ade
n
ov
Fix
l
ist destructuring of unions
commit
|
commitdiff
|
tree
2019-06-24
Bill F
u
me
r
o
l
a
remove par
s
e
r knowledge
t
hat
C
::C
i
s a
c
onstruc
t
or
.
.
.
commit
|
commitdiff
|
tree
2019-06-24
Bi
l
l Fumerol
a
HH_global_key_exists directly through hot RDS
commit
|
commitdiff
|
tree
2019-06-24
Wil
f
red
H
u
g
h
e
s
Impro
v
e error me
s
sa
g
e on misplaced
a
s
ync
m
odifiers
commit
|
commitdiff
|
tree
2019-06-24
F
red
E
mmott
u
p
date version
.
h
commit
|
commitdiff
|
tree
2019-06-24
A
rnab De
Generated full_fidelity
f
iles for r
e
cord inher
i
t
a
n
c
e
.
.
.
commit
|
commitdiff
|
tree
2019-06-24
Katy Voor
Allow abstract methods to o
v
e
rride abstr
a
ct methods
commit
|
commitdiff
|
tree
2019-06-24
Bi
n
Liu
use
a thread-lo
c
al pointer to
st
a
ck elements
commit
|
commitdiff
|
tree
2019-06-24
Sasha Manzyuk
Fix
cr
e
ation of expression d
e
p
e
ndent t
y
pes from nullable
.
.
.
commit
|
commitdiff
|
tree
2019-06-24
Tatiana Rach
e
va
Python integration te
s
t
s
for m
e
rging
part
i
al
state
commit
|
commitdiff
|
tree
2019-06-24
Tatiana Rach
e
va
Merge partial dep tables
i
nto a si
n
gle SQLite table
commit
|
commitdiff
|
tree
2019-06-24
Sasha
M
anzyuk
R
e
place Unsat
f
w
ith
Disj (
f
, [])
commit
|
commitdiff
|
tree
2019-06-24
Alexey Toptygin
Re
n
am
e
imm
u
t
ab
l
e => const for objects
.
commit
|
commitdiff
|
tree
2019-06-24
R
ick Lavoie
Add p
e
r-PID support
t
o
HPHP_
T
RACE_FILE
commit
|
commitdiff
|
tree
2019-06-24
Bin Liu
av
o
id accid
e
ntally hold big buffers in simp
l
e j
s
on
.
.
.
commit
|
commitdiff
|
tree
2019-06-24
Ja
n
Oravec
Fix refc
o
unt opts segfault
commit
|
commitdiff
|
tree
2019-06-23
Rick L
a
voie
Fix HHBBC DCE of NewKey
s
etArr
a
y and f
a
mily
commit
|
commitdiff
|
tree
2019-06-23
Bin Liu
intr
o
duce
o
p
t
ion for n
u
mber of reserved slabs
commit
|
commitdiff
|
tree
2019-06-22
Bill Fumerola
remov
e
Obj
e
c
t
Data:
:
p
r
opB,Arr
a
y::
l
valA
t
Ref
commit
|
commitdiff
|
tree
2019-06-22
Oguz Ulgen
C
o
r
r
ectly namespace ty
p
e parameters in ty
p
e con
s
t
a
nts
commit
|
commitdiff
|
tree
2019-06-22
Oguz Ulgen
Di
s
t
inguish between opaque and
tr
a
n
s
parent
t
ype aliases
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
Oguz Ulge
n
Fix a bu
g
i
n v
e
rifyp
a
ram
t
ype a
n
d ver
i
fyrettype rega
r
ding
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
Oguz U
l
gen
Resp
e
ct soft annotation for t
y
pe
s
tructures that fail
e
d
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
R
i
ck Lavoie
Add trivial constant optimiza
t
ion
to vas
m
-graph-color
commit
|
commitdiff
|
tree
2019-06-22
Waleed Khan
Al
w
ays rea
d
fil
e
s from di
s
k for `File
_
p
ro
v
ider` with
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
W
a
l
e
e
d Khan
Support local-
m
emory caching for `Dec
l
_provid
e
r`
commit
|
commitdiff
|
tree
2019-06-22
Wale
e
d K
h
an
Create
`M
e
mory_bo
u
nded_lr
u
_cache` as an alternative
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
Wal
e
ed Kh
a
n
Impleme
n
t
`Identify
_
symbol` usin
g
an AST as input
commit
|
commitdiff
|
tree
2019-06-22
J
an Ora
v
ec
Col
l
ect statistic
s
about number of i
n
line attem
p
t
s
.
.
.
commit
|
commitdiff
|
tree
2019-06-22
Bin L
i
u
u
se loca
l
all
o
cator in
O
BC has
h
table
commit
|
commitdiff
|
tree
2019-06-22
T
ho
m
as
J
iang
I
n
v
a
li
d
ate
fil
e
s via hh
_
se
r
ver [with
opt
i
ons]
commit
|
commitdiff
|
tree
2019-06-22
Ken
n
eth Li
Mov
e
enforce
m
ent
o
f
a
r
raykey
for `BuiltinEnum` to
.
.
.
commit
|
commitdiff
|
tree
2019-06-21
Ted Spence
Test suite
fo
r
d
o
cblocks
commit
|
commitdiff
|
tree
2019-06-21
Xilun Wu
Add class-level where
c
lauses
s
upport - Part
1 F
u
ll
.
.
.
commit
|
commitdiff
|
tree
2019-06-21
Kevin
V
ira
t
yos
i
n
preg_repl
a
ce_callback s
h
ou
l
d pass
darrays to the
callback
commit
|
commitdiff
|
tree
2019-06-21
Mike Qia
n
M
ark r
e
maining f
u
nctions in
bu
i
lt
i
ns
_
array
.
h
h
i a
s
_
_PHPSt
d
L
ib
commit
|
commitdiff
|
tree
2019-06-21
Vas
s
il Ml
a
denov
C
hec
k
__Enforceabl
e
type c
o
n
stants for
c
a
ses that are
.
.
.
commit
|
commitdiff
|
tree
2019-06-21
Vassil
Mladenov
Further restrict abstract type
constants with def
a
ults
commit
|
commitdiff
|
tree
2019-06-21
Rick
L
a
voie
Repla
c
e VregSet::forEach w
i
th
i
terators
commit
|
commitdiff
|
tree
2019-06-21
Rick
L
avoie
Remove cop
y
args vasm simplificatio
n
r
u
le
commit
|
commitdiff
|
tree
2019-06-21
Katja G
o
ltsova
When
passed a functio
n
w
i
th --extrac
t
-standalone, e
x
tra
c
t
.
.
.
commit
|
commitdiff
|
tree
2019-06-21
Julia Pitts
Fix order o
f
ch
e
c
ks
in resolve_init_a
p
proach
.
commit
|
commitdiff
|
tree
2019-06-21
Jake Bailey
(
Hackl
a
ng)
Do not open
D
e
c
l
_to_typing
i
n Decl_inheritance
commit
|
commitdiff
|
tree
2019-06-21
Ted Spence
Unif
i
ed
s
ymbol
-
to
-
docbl
o
ck serve
r
command
commit
|
commitdiff
|
tree
2019-06-21
Sasha Manzyu
k
Better e
r
ror
messages fo
r
disjunct
i
on
s
:
propagat
e
the
.
.
.
commit
|
commitdiff
|
tree
2019-06-21
Oguz Ulgen
Add a helper to
emi
t
t
ry catch
commit
|
commitdiff
|
tree
2019-06-21
An
d
rew K
e
nn
e
dy
Subtyping of null
a
ble <: union
commit
|
commitdiff
|
tree
2019-06-21
Vi
n
cent Siles
fi
x
i
n
tegration_
m
l/t
e
st_all
f
or dune
commit
|
commitdiff
|
tree
2019-06-21
Andrew Kennedy
Simplify XHP c
h
ec
k
in TAST c
h
e
cking
commit
|
commitdiff
|
tree
2019-06-21
Ben Harriso
n
Add
E
ntryPoints t
o
a few more tests
.
commit
|
commitdiff
|
tree
2019-06-21
Shaunak Kishore
Use array
p
rofiling to
opt
i
m
ize
S
hapes:
:
idx
commit
|
commitdiff
|
tree
2019-06-21
Shau
n
ak Kishore
Make Shapes::i
d
x a nati
v
e builtin
commit
|
commitdiff
|
tree
2019-06-21
Shauna
k
Kishor
e
R
e
duce Tre
a
dHashMap load factor
commit
|
commitdiff
|
tree
2019-06-21
V
a
s
sil Mladenov
Fix
r
e
gr
e
ssion on def
a
ults for a
b
stract
type con
s
tan
t
s
commit
|
commitdiff
|
tree
2019-06-21
Jan
Ora
v
e
c
Allow different
inl
i
ning cost factors f
o
r main/cold
.
.
.
commit
|
commitdiff
|
tree
2019-06-20
J
an Oravec
D
e
cRef: dire
c
tly call
O
bjectData:
:
r
e
lease()
e
ven if
.
.
.
commit
|
commitdiff
|
tree
2019-06-20
Dwayne Reeves
Remove
typecon
s
t_s
e
en
from Typi
n
g
_t
a
cces
s
.
env
commit
|
commitdiff
|
tree
2019-06-20
Kenneth Li
Weaken darray ke
y
constrai
n
t to ~array
k
ey for era
s
ed
.
.
.
commit
|
commitdiff
|
tree
2019-06-20
Jake Bailey (Ha
c
klang)
Destr
u
cture s
h
allow cla
s
s
memb
e
rs in Decl_to_typ
i
ng
.
.
.
commit
|
commitdiff
|
tree
2019-06-20
J
a
k
e
Ba
i
ley (Hackl
a
ng)
R
en
a
me
i
n
h
eritab
l
e_e
l
t
to tagged_elt
commit
|
commitdiff
|
tree
2019-06-20
Jake Bailey (Hack
l
ang)
Move Dec
l
_in
h
eritance help
e
rs to D
e
cl_
t
o_typing
commit
|
commitdiff
|
tree
2019-06-20
Steve C
a
o
fix xh
p
attri parse err
o
r
commit
|
commitdiff
|
tree
2019-06-20
A
r
nab D
e
Typeh
i
nt check
f
or
r
e
c
o
rd inher
i
tance
commit
|
commitdiff
|
tree
2019-06-20
Arnab
De
Inclu
d
e parent fields in de
r
ive
d
r
eco
r
d
commit
|
commitdiff
|
tree
next